参考词汇 | ||
| attract fascinate enchant charm | ||
| 都含有“吸引”, 或“给人以喜悦之感”的意思。 | ||
(1) |
attract 指“以悦人的恣态使人喜欢、羡慕或注目”, 如: | |
| He was attracted by her beauty. | ||
| 他被她的美貌所吸引。 | ||
(2) |
fascinate 指“使人非常感兴趣, 以致于要继续看下去或做下去等”, 如: | |
| The children were fascinated by all the toys in the shop windows. | ||
| 那些孩子被商店橱窗里所有的玩具迷住了。 | ||
(3) |
charm 指“使 人喜悦”、“使迷醉”, 如: | |
| Her beautiful voice charms everyone. | ||
| 她优美的声音迷醉了每个人。 | ||
(4) |
enchant 通常为由于喜悦而“着迷”, 如: | |
| She was enchanted by the flowers you sent her. | ||
| 她非常喜欢你送给她的花。 | ||
